GO:0048225Namesuberin network
DefinitionAn extracellular matrix part that consists of fatty acid-derived polymers, including both aromatic and aliphatic components. The suberin network is found in specialized plant cell walls, where it is laid down between the primary wall and plasma membrane, forms protective and wound-healing layers, and provides a water-impermeable diffusion barrier.
